Transaction 5370f78987e9a23cfaf556466bb98552cb3177883aab34d72e63d76196984285
1 Input
1 Output
-
5370f78987e9a23cfaf556466bb98552cb3177883aab34d72e63d76196984285:0
- value
- 23989254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e725a5cb9c0f25625cbda2ddc1372759926e722 OP_EQUAL
- address
- 3DDc46fmMyUACYuyWPkysUuzywo5VGco1z